1. Kinds of Taxes Levied on Casinos
Governments impose numerous varieties of taxes on casinos, Every single intended to capture a portion of the financial action produced from the gambling business. These taxes can vary considerably from one jurisdiction to a different, determined by regional rules, economic priorities, and regulatory frameworks.

a. Gaming Taxes

The commonest type of taxation on casinos would be the gaming tax, which happens to be levied on the earnings produced from gambling activities. This tax is often calculated for a percentage of your casino's gross gaming earnings (GGR), and that is the entire amount wagered by gamers minus the winnings paid out. Gaming taxes can differ extensively, with fees ranging from as little as 1% in a few jurisdictions to as high as fifty% or maybe more in Other folks.

For instance, in The usa, gaming tax premiums differ by point out, with Nevada imposing a graduated tax price that commences at three.5% and goes approximately six.75%, even though Pennsylvania imposes a much larger level of 54% on slot device revenues. In Macau, the whole world's greatest gambling hub, casinos are subject matter to a 39% tax charge on their own gross gaming profits, contributing significantly to the government's income foundation.

b. Company Money Taxes

As well as gaming taxes, casinos will also be issue to company earnings taxes on their own profits. These taxes are similar to Individuals imposed on other corporations and they are based on the net cash flow gained through the On line casino soon after accounting for expenditures such as salaries, utilities, and marketing. Company earnings taxes deliver A different crucial supply of income for governments, encouraging making sure that casinos contribute rather to public finances.

The speed of company earnings tax applied to casinos can vary based on the jurisdiction and the precise tax procedures in position. In some countries, casinos may perhaps take pleasure in tax incentives or deductions targeted at encouraging financial commitment and task creation, though in Some others, they may be issue to better charges to replicate their exceptional economic effects.

c. Licensing Costs and Levies

Governments might also impose licensing service fees and levies on casinos as Portion of the regulatory framework governing the industry. These expenses are typically charged for the right to function a casino and will often be necessary to be compensated upfront or yearly. Licensing expenses could be considerable, especially in jurisdictions wherever casino licenses are constrained and really sought after.

Licensing costs provide a number of needs. They offer a direct source of income for governments, make sure only financially stable and reliable operators enter the industry, and help go over The prices connected to regulating the industry, including monitoring compliance and imposing gaming legislation.

d. Other Taxes and Contributions

Casinos could also be subject matter to other sorts of taxation and contributions, which include property taxes, payroll taxes, and value-added taxes (VAT) on non-gaming actions like dining, entertainment, and retail revenue. Furthermore, some jurisdictions call for casinos for making immediate contributions to Local community money, social plans, or dilemma gambling initiatives being a issue of their license.

2. The Financial Effects of On line casino Tax Profits
Casino tax revenue provides significant financial Added benefits to governments and communities, supporting a wide array of public solutions and development initiatives. The effects of the income is often witnessed in numerous key spots:

a. Funding Community Providers and Infrastructure

Certainly one of the first strategies governments gain from casino tax profits is by using it to fund general public providers and infrastructure projects. Revenues from casinos is often allocated to varied locations, for instance training, Health care, transportation, and public basic safety. In many situations, these funds supply a secure and predictable source of cash flow that assists governments sustain and make improvements to crucial services with no boosting taxes on residents.

For example, in numerous U.S. states, a percentage of the revenue generated by casinos is earmarked for schooling funding. States like Pennsylvania and New Jersey use On line casino tax revenues to support public educational institutions, universities, and scholarship programs, offering crucial means for students and educators. Similarly, in Macau, the government employs gaming tax profits to fund social welfare courses, general public housing, and Health care services, contributing to the overall nicely-getting of its inhabitants.

b. Economic Growth and Career Development

On line casino tax income could also assist economic growth and task development attempts. By reinvesting gambling revenues into Neighborhood improvement tasks, governments can stimulate economic activity, entice new companies, and create work prospects. This is particularly crucial in regions where other varieties of financial activity may be confined or declining.

One example is, in Singapore, the government has utilized earnings produced by its integrated resorts, Marina Bay Sands and Resorts Environment Sentosa, to assist tourism advancement, infrastructure improvements, and career education applications. This solution has aided Singapore establish by itself as a global tourism hub and make A huge number of jobs from the hospitality, retail, and enjoyment sectors.

c. Lessening Funds Deficits and Debt

In moments of financial downturn or fiscal anxiety, On line casino tax earnings can offer a significant buffer for governments planning to cut down spending plan deficits and handle public debt. The continual movement of profits from casinos might help offset declines in other tax bases, including revenue or income taxes, and provide a source of liquidity for governments dealing with economical difficulties.

This was specifically evident throughout the COVID-19 pandemic, when numerous governments faced substantial budget shortfalls as a result of declining financial activity. In jurisdictions the place casinos remained operational or quickly tailored to on the web platforms, gambling tax revenue presented a crucial supply of income that served mitigate the fiscal influence on the pandemic.

3. Social and Ethical Implications of Dependence on Gambling Income
Although the economic benefits of On line casino tax revenue are substantial, You can also find social and moral implications connected to govt reliance on gambling cash. These issues increase crucial questions about the role of gambling in general public coverage along with the prospective hazards of overdependence on this source of money.

a. The Social Expenditures of Gambling

One among the principal issues related to dependence on On line casino tax income will be the social expense of gambling. Dilemma gambling can result in An array of adverse outcomes, together with fiscal hardship, mental medical issues, partnership breakdowns, and amplified need for social solutions. These social expenditures can offset the economic advantages of gambling revenue and generate additional burdens for governments and communities.

Governments that rely intensely on gambling earnings could face strain to equilibrium the need for cash flow with the duty to shield public overall health and welfare. This can generate ethical dilemmas, notably when it comes to advertising and marketing accountable gambling methods, regulating advertising, and supporting habit treatment method applications.

b. The potential risk of Economic Overdependence

A different problem is the chance of financial overdependence on gambling profits. Regions that depend closely on casino taxes for community funding may be prone to financial shocks, including variations in buyer habits, increased Competitiveness, or regulatory changes. Overdependence on an individual field can produce economic instability and Restrict a authorities's potential to reply to changing economic situations.

One example is, Atlantic Town, New Jersey, experienced considerable economic issues when Level of competition from neighboring states and changes in purchaser Choices led to a drop in casino revenues. The city's reliance on gambling profits created it hard to diversify its economy and reply to these problems, causing task losses, price range deficits, and financial decrease.
